Her Undying Faith  Cover Image Book Book

Her Undying Faith / Joy Ohagwu.

Ohagwu, Joy, (author.).

Summary:

All Sharon Parsons wanted was a chance to be with the man she loved. But her Mom, Stella Heart, disapproved of their relationship due to his perceived character. And, he didn't share her Christian faith. Feeling stuck in the middle, and desperate for some freedom, her patience was running out. Then Sharon made an aggressive choice to bridge the gap, but her plan not only backfired, it ruined her future. When circumstances forced them apart, she gave up on any chance of redemption, both for his soul and of their love. Little did she know that the moment she gave up, God picked up her broken pieces and began writing a new story that even she could not have predicted.
